Originally Posted by momo20
very interesting I would be curious as to how this affects the cars ability to cool itself
Hey Momo

We discuss this in detail in one of these design pic threads.
The undercar air deflector is still quite a bit lower than the front fascia.(The center of the fascia is only 2 inches lower than the stock piece) It should receive plenty of air. Thanks for the comment

The OEM rocker panels and front end are being used. We are just fabricating them to be lower with a little more beef and wheel wrap.
